However, while … WebMar 2, 2024 · With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I), you cannot earn more than what is considered “ substantial gainful activity ” or SGA. For 2024, SGA is set at $1,470 per month. With Supplemental Security Income (SSI), you cannot have significant income or other assets, as this is a need-based program.
